Usage
Used primarily by Retail Industry, in U.S.A. and Canada. One dimensional, continuous, four element widths and fixed length. Left 6-10 digits assigned by Uniform Code Council, rest to total of 11 digits is selected by you, 12th is check digit, calculated by mod 10 formula. Version A is 12 digits. Version E is 6 digits. A 2-digit add-on is used by periodicals and a 5-digit add-on is used on paper back books and greeting cards. On January 1, 2005 this symbology will look like EAN and it will be called GTIN (Global Trade Item Number)
Character set 0-9 only
Module Width (X) 0.013" @ 100%
Height 1.02" @ 100% (from top of the bars to bottom of the numbers, if you don't have a decimal ruler use 1 1/16")
Width 1.235" @ 100%
Quiet Zone 0.117" @ 100% (if you don't have a decimal ruler use 1/8")
Range 80% - 200% for press printed (76% for thermal transfer and laser printed, but must use height and quiet zone requirements of the 80% symbol)

 

ean-code-example Usage
Used primarily by Retail Industry, in Europe and the rest of the world and is a superset of U.P.C. One dimensional, continuous, four element widths and fixed length. Left 7-11 digits assigned by EAN governing body, rest to total of 12 digits is selected by you, 13th is check digit, calculated by mod 10 formula. EAN13 has 13 digits and EAN8 has 8 digits.

Usage
Used only by the book industry. It is an EAN-13 with 5-digit add-on. Based on ISBN assigned by R. R. Bowker. Starts with Country code of 978, followed by the left 9 digits of ISBN, 13th is check digit, calculated by mod 10 formula.
For add on, start with 5 for U.S. Dollars followed with price ($7.95 -> 50795) if no price, must put 90000 for the 5 digit add-on.
NEW! As of Jan. 1, 2007 all 10 digit ISBN's must become 13 digit ISBN's to fit into Global TGIN system. Addition of two lines of text above the code helps to address that. First line lists all thirteen digits (978 plus 10 digits), second line lists only the original 10 digits.

qr-code-example Usage
A QR Code is a type of 2D barcode that is frequently used by consumers to information about something on the web. The GS1 identifiers and data that brands and retailers use today for their products can be used in a QR code too! GS1 Digital Link is a format for doing just that, making products web-friendly, allowing for more robust consumer engagement, while still enabling supply chain functions, like price look up.

datamatrix-code-example Usage

Data Matrix can encode a large amount of data in a relatively small space. A data matrix comes in square and rectangular versions and contains built-in error correction that adds to their reliability. Like a QR code, they can link to websites with product information.

It is a 2D barcode that is used in a variety of applications. GS1 Data Matrix is used extensively on medical devices, pharmaceuticals, and other healthcare products. Additionally, GS1 Data Matrix is used in fresh foods, construction, and other products that require more information beyond the standard barcode. 

This web-friendly URL data format allows a Data Matrix to connect users to online resources just like a QR Code does.

Width Range: 10 x 10 module up to 144 x 144 module

interleaved2of5-code-example Usage Used primarily by distribution industry. High density, self-checking, continuous. Every character encodes two digits, one in the bars and on in the spaces therefore the symbol must have even number of digits.
Character set 0-9 only
Module Width (X) 0.0075" min.
Height 15% of width, 0.25" min.
Width Variable
Ratio 2-3, 2.2 min. for X<0.02"
Quiet Zone 10X, 0.25" min.

 

shipping-container-code-example Usage Based on Interleaved 2 of 5, Must have 14 digits.
1st digit based on packaging level, 2nd digit 0, 3rd to 13th same as UPC (or 2nd to 13th same as EAN). 14th is check digit, calculated by mod 10 formula.
Module Width (X) 0.040" @ 1.00 Magnification
Height 1.25" @ 1.00 Magnification
Width 4.82" @ 1.00 Magnification
Ratio 2.5
Quiet Zone 0.40" @ 1.00 Magnification(if you don't have a decimal ruler use 13/32")
Range 0.7 to 1.2 Magnification Factor for printing on corrugated. (0.625 to 1.2 Magnification Factor for labels)

codabar-code-example Usage
Used primarily by libraries, blood banks air parcel industry. Discrete, self-checking, variable length. Four different start/stop characters allow useful in formation to be encoded in these overhead characters.
Character set 0-9, - $ : / . + (A, B, C, D as start/stop)
Module Width (X) 0.0075" min.
Height 15% of width, 0.25" min.
Width Variable
Quiet Zone 10X, 0.25" min.

 

code3of9-code-example Usage
First and the most popular alphanumeric bar code. Used by a wide range of industries. Discrete, self-checking, variable length. Mod 43 check digit is optional for security. Extended version will code lower case and ASCII. Readers must be programed to decode the extended format.
Character set 0-9, A-Z, - . space $ / + %
Module Width (X) 0.0075" min
Height 15% of width, 0.25" min.
Width Variable
Ratio 2-3, 2.2 min. for X<0.02"
Quiet Zone 10X, 0.25" min.

 

hibc-code-example Usage (Health Industry Bar Code) Used primarily by health industry. Based on code 39 with mod 43 check digit.
Must start with a "+"

c128-code-example Usage
Newest of the popular bar codes, very high density, variable length, continuous, multiple widths, and has internal check digit. There are three sub sets, A, B & C. in Sub set C, 00 to 99 only, must have even number of digits.
Character set All 128 ASCII characters
Module Width (X) 0.0075" min.
Height 15% of width, 0.25" min.
Width Variable
Quiet Zone 10X, 0.25" min.
